How Breathing Pacer Apps Support Families

A breathing pacer serves as a straightforward app-based resource that prompts family members through timed inhale and exhale cycles. In family therapy sessions at Eye Cue Mental Health, therapists use breathing pacer apps at key moments to help parents and children settle into a shared rhythm. Research confirms that shared breathing among family members builds co-regulation.

Incorporating a breathing pacer within family therapy proves especially effective when verbal communication becomes difficult. Instead of pushing through a charged discussion, the therapist shifts the household to a short breathing pacer exercise. What role does a breathing pacer benefit families in therapy?

A breathing pacer prompts participants through paced inhale-exhale patterns that activate the parasympathetic nervous system. This shared breathing practice enables co-regulation, so that loved ones settle at the same time rather than separately.

Can you explain co-regulation in family therapy?

Co-regulation is the experience by which family members help each other regulate nervous system activation together. In family therapy at Eye Cue Mental Health, co-regulation techniques including synchronized breathwork create attunement and lower conflict between family members.
